MUMBAI, Aug. 17 (Xinhua) -- Bengaluru, capital of India's southwestern state Karnataka, has been on high security alert with armed police deployed across the city on Saturday.

The alert followed an advisory note from the City Police Commissioner Bhaskar Rao to his deputies to intensify security at all iconic installations and public places in the city.

It also ensured functioning of CCTVs at key check points to watch out for vehicles moving in a suspicious manner.

"There should be a high-level police presence and visibility at the jurisdictional level until further orders," said a newspaper report quoting the advisory note.

While the tone of the advisory note was serious, the top cop of the city later tried to downplay the high alert, terming it as a security drill to check how well the city is prepared in terms of a security threat.
